EL PASO, Texas (KTSM) — A 32-year-old man was identified and arrested for shoplifting after video posted to social media showed a theft at a retail store, Las Cruces Police said.
Las Cruces Police have arrested David Alan Leonard, 32, for shoplifting more than $500 from a shoe store in Las Cruces.
With the assistance from Retail Asset Protection partners, the Community Outreach Unit of LCPD identified Leonard as the masked individual responsible for the series of thefts, Las Cruces Police said.
The investigation, which spanned several months, revealed that the shoplifter would enter retail stores multiple times a day while concealing his face with a mask. Investigators will continue collaborating with retail businesses to identify each incident and pursue charges based on the total value of the stolen goods, Las Cruces Police said.
A felony arrest warrant was issued for Leonard. He was locatred and arrested without incident, Las Cruces Police said.
It is believed that the shoplifter is working with a local organized retail theft group, so the investigation will remain open, Las Cruces Police said.
